A particle moves along a circle of radius'r' with constant tangential acceleration. If the velocity of the particle is 'v' at the end of second revolution , after the revolution has started then the tangential accleration is

A

`(v^2)/(8pir)`

B

`(v^2)/(6pir)`

C

`(v^2)/(4pir)`

D

`(v^2)/(2pir)`

Text Solution

Verified by Experts

The correct Answer is:
A
